A Postgraduate Certificate in Wildlife Rehabilitation Leadership equips professionals with advanced knowledge and skills to lead and manage wildlife rehabilitation centers effectively. This specialized program focuses on developing leadership qualities essential for successful wildlife conservation efforts.
Learning outcomes include mastering strategic planning for wildlife rehabilitation facilities, improving team management and communication skills within a conservation context, and developing expertise in fundraising and resource allocation specific to wildlife care. Students also gain proficiency in implementing best practices for animal welfare and ethical considerations in wildlife rehabilitation.
The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Wildlife Rehabilitation Leadership typically ranges from six months to one year, depending on the institution and program structure. The curriculum is often modular, allowing flexibility for working professionals. Many programs incorporate practical fieldwork and mentorship opportunities, enhancing real-world applicability.
